Interoute Telecommunications Ltd. Extranet
Interoute's Extranet was designed to allow Interoute employees and customers to manage joint projects and share information.
The system was designed to be secure as well as allow users to have a moderate amount of control over the system.
The Extranet was split into two main features - a project management side, allowing users to set specific tasks and monitor
the task's progress, and a document management side allowing the uploading and sharing of documents.
Project Management
The Project Management system allowed Interoute Employees and their customers to enter tasks, with any relevant information, that required doing.
These tasks would then be available to the relevant party who could assign the task to a memeber of their staff who would then complete the task.
The system had a number of features:
- Fully user controlled.
The system was designed to be fully controlled by the users with no required input from the Web Services team.
Interoute employees could set up new customers initially and then pass control to the customer to set up any additional users.
Should a user forget their password, users with administration rights would be able to reset the password for them.
- Automated email notification.
For certain actions the system would automatically email any relevant users of the changes. These included overriding
passwords, task status changes and overdue reminders. The email would clearly explain where it was from and why it had been sent
ensuring that all users would always be kept up to date with any relevant information.
- Very easy to use.
To ensure that new users would be able to use the system very easily, it was designed to only allow users control of a set task
when it was relevant to that them, though it would always be viewable. The design meant that users would be gently led through the
system rather than simply allowing a list of options.
- Reporting system.
The reporting system allowed users on both sides to see the current status of all the relevant tasks. Through the system users could
select the criteria of the tasks that they would like to see (all, unassigned, overdue, etc...)
